The third Method and Tune books are now available in this course by Gabriel Koeppen. Tranlated from the hugely successful German Celloschule method The Koeppen Cello Method consists of 3 progressive method books, each with a supplementary tune book, and lays the foundation for a solid technical and musical training. Structured in an easy and understandable way and full of fun rhythmic exercises and popular styles, it is aimed at young people and adults. The Tune Books offer a wealth of repertoire, from the Baroque to the Romantic era, and also feature popular folk songs as well as modern pieces in fresh, new, fun-to-play arrangements.
